At Annikki, we are committed to transforming the chemical landscape by innovating and implementing sustainable, bio-based technologies that significantly reduce costs, energy consumption, and gre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ions. Founded in 2007, Annikki has pioneered cutting-edge technologies to make the chemical industry both environmentally friendly and economically viable.
Annikki develops biochemical processes to replace petrochemical products with biobased products while reducing energy consumption and the impact on the environment. The technology enables a vast array of product lines to be derived from plants rather than from petroleum. Our sphere of activity extends from enzyme development and improvement to the development of new bio-catalytic processes. 100% of our processes and technology are based on biogenic raw materials.
